International County Risk Guide (ICRG)
The International Country Risk Guide (ICRG) rating comprises 22 variables in three subcategories of risk: political, financial, and economic. This update expands the series through 2011.  Both annual and monthly risk datasets are available for download- see page for details.

ITERATE - International Terrorism: Attributes of Terrorist Events
The ITERATE project is an attempt to quantify data on the characteristics of transnational terrorist groups, their activities which have international impact, and the environment in which they operate. This update expands the series through 2011.

Latin American Public Opinion Project (LAPOP)
The Latin American Public Opinion Project produces surveys analyzing public perceptions of the role of government, political tolerance, citizen participation, and corruption among other issues. This update provides new data that stretch the series back to as early as 1973, depending on the country.

Population Estimates, 1990-2009
The U.S. Census Population Estimates provide county-level, annual population estimates by race and ethnicity for 1990-2009. Data are specific to counties, and a subset covering North Carolina only is also available.

North Carolina Census 2010 Data - Counties and Tracts
The Data and GIS Services Department has compiled a variety of Census 2010 indicators for North Carolina counties and census tracts. These layers are designed to mirror the Census series found in the Esri Data and Maps collection. Data are available for North Carolina counties and tracts.

USDA Aerial Photographs - Durham County
This collection provides historical aerial photographs of Durham County, North Carolina for 1955, 1960, and 1966. The interface has been redesigned to use Google Maps.
